Rafa declares 'This is the beginning of something important'

Liverpool manager Rafa Benitez has praised the quality of the team, declaring they are closing in on United and ‘can beat anyone’. The Reds made vast improvements last season and accumulated their best ever points tally in the Premiership. "If you analyse the number of points, 86, you see it's a record for the club in the Premier League," Benitez told the official web site.

"We are going forward, we are progressing. For the future this is good news and hopefully this is the beginning of something important.

"In terms of the consistency of the team we've been really good. The squad is better, the mentality is very good and the players are competing for their positions."

Speaking about twice beating United last season, including the devastating 1-4 thrashing at Old Trafford, Benitez said: "We won against them twice this year. We've shown we can beat anyone. Clearly we have enough quality in the team. The squad is good but against us United had Giggs, Scholes and Berbatov on the bench.”

"Each year is different but we are closer, we have more confidence, and the experience of this year will be good for next season. You never know but it seems like we are reducing the gap."

Rafa’s backroom staff played an imperative role last season and Benitez thinks their winning spirit will benefit the team: "Mauricio has shown he is a great coach," added Benitez. "He is someone with passion who knows the game. But he has the same problem as Sammy Lee - he has to improve his English!

"It's very good for us to have people like Sammy and Mauricio because they've both won trophies. They both know what it means to fight in the top leagues. They know what it means to make finals.

"The experience they have is really good for the players."
